Types of Treadmills
When it concerns choosing a Treadmill Home, it is essential to understand the various types offered in the market. Here are the primary classifications:
1. Manual TreadmillsMechanism: These treadmills have a simple design and rely on the user's efforts to move the belt.Pros: More budget-friendly, quieter operation, no electricity needed.Cons: Limited features, might not provide the very same variety of workout strength.2. Motorized TreadmillsSystem: Powered by a motor that drives the belt, permitting users to stroll or perform at a set speed.Pros: Greater variety of speeds and slopes, equipped with many functions such as heart rate screens and workout programs.Cons: More pricey and may need more maintenance.3. Folding TreadmillsSystem: Designed for those with restricted area, these treadmills can be folded for easy storage.Pros: Space-saving, often motorized, flexible features.Cons: May be less long lasting than non-folding designs.4. Business TreadmillsSystem: High-quality machines designed for use in health clubs and gym.Pros: Built to stand up to heavy usage, advanced features, frequently consist of service warranties.Cons: Pricey and not ideal for home usage due to size.5. Treadmills provide numerous advantages that can contribute to one's overall health and wellness objectives. Some of these advantages consist of:

When selecting a treadmill, prospective purchasers should think about several key aspects:

How frequently should I utilize a treadmill?
It is advised to utilize a treadmill a minimum of three to five times a week, integrating numerous strength levels for best outcomes.
2. Can I lose weight by utilizing a treadmill?
Yes, constant use of a treadmill can add to weight reduction, specifically when integrated with a well balanced diet and strength training.
3. What is the best speed to stroll on a treadmill for newbies?
A speed of 3 to 4 miles per hour is an ideal range for newbies. It's vital to begin sluggish and gradually increase speed as comfort and endurance improve.
4. Do I require to utilize a treadmill if I already run outdoors?
Using a treadmill can supply fringe benefits, such as controlled environments and differed workouts (incline, intervals) that are not constantly possible outdoors.
5. How do I maintain my treadmill?
Regular maintenance consists of oiling the belt, cleaning up the deck and console, and inspecting the motor for ideal performance.
